Appleton fire kills animals, destroys barn

  • Source: WABI-TV CBS/CW+ 5 Bangor
  • Published: 04/18/2024 10:19 AM

PHOTOS: Nearly 20 animals were killed in a barn that was destroyed by fire Thursday morning in Appleton. Appleton Fire Chief Prent Marriner says they were called to the fire around 2:30 a.m. When they arrived, the fire had spread to a truck nearby. Most of the livestock was outside, but a dozen chickens and five piglets inside died in the fire. It was knocked down quickly, but firefighters spent hours going through bales of hay in the barn looking for hotspots. Six departments responded to the scene. The chief says there is too much damage to know what caused the fire, but he believes it could have been caused by electrical equipment in the barn.
